TMS34010 CPU Speedup in MAME:
EmuViews is reporting that the TMS34010 CPU core in MAME has got a major speed up. The TMS34010 drives games like Mortal Kombat and Smash TV and others. If you have a Pentium 400+, it's very possible that you will be running at full speed very shortly.

Midway Classics Coming to the Internet:
A few days ago I reported that Atari and Shockwave teamed up to release freely playable internet versions of Super Breakout, Centipede, Frogger, and Missile Command. Well now it seems that Midway will also be doing this with their classics. Dream reports that initially 10 titles will be available including Defender, Joust, Spy Hunter, Moon Patrol and Marble Madness. You will be able to download them and play at full screen. They'll "soon" be available on Shockwave's site at the above link (as the press release reads). After 3 months, they'll also be available on Midway's own website.

IBM 650 Simulator:
This has got to be the most bizarre simulator to date. It simulates an IBM 650 magnetic drum data-processing machine on your web browser (via Java). If you don't know what an IBM 650 is, it's the old IBM punch card type computer (if your not old enough, you probably still don't know what I'm talking about). In any case, it's VERY retro. I remember my father taking me to the Bowling Green State University's computer lab to run programs on this monster. It was my first computer experience and I vividly remember playing tic-tac-toe where the display was a dot-matrix printer. It made a life-long impression on me. Athlon 900 MHz Released:
If you haven't heard of KryoTech before, they design CPU cooling systems that allow CPUs to run at higher speeds. We are not talking fans here, but a compressor that cools the CPU down to around -40°C. AMD even officially endorses their technology including this 900MHz Athlon. A case with the cooling compressor, motherboard, and CPU is $2200. This unit is a few weeks old, but I'm sure that a 1GHz model will be released shortly with Athlon 750 just around the corner.
